How about if Sena created a universal wireless kit (unit hardwired on the bike, two -or even more, sidecars!- headsets) that would allow streaming stereo to the helmets and at the same time the microphone signal back to unit on the bike? Additionally either the main unit or (most likely) the individual helmets would be able to pair to mobile phones.
Such a setup would keep all controls to what is already available onboard, no hassle with circuitry for PTT or whatever else. It just cuts the wires to the helmets and adds mobile phone operation.
I had understood that based on the official Bluetooth profiles this could not be supported, but having read the datasheet of the BlueAudio KC-6112 Bluetooth module (KCSI profile), I would say this should not be impossible anymore!
